Vitamin E is composed of the following eight antioxidants: four tocopherols (alpha, beta, gamma, delta) and four tocotrienols (alpha, beta, gamma, delta). Alpha-tocopherol is the form of Vitamin E found in the largest amount in blood and tissue in the body and this suggests that it is the most bioavailable.

What is Alpha-Tocopherol?
Alpha Tocopherol functions as an antioxidant, and, as a fat-soluble compound, it is particularly effective against cellular oxidation which occurs at the cellular membrane where fat/lipid layer resides (fats are particularly susceptible to oxidation). Alpha Tocopherol has also been shown to prevent LDL oxidation and platelet aggregation.

What are Tocotrienols?
Tocotrienols have antioxidant activity. They may also have hypocholesterolemic, anti-atherogenic, antithrombotic, anticarcinogenic and immunomodulatory actions
